You must purchase a BAM spectator pass to compete.
Please register for the cosplay competition at the registration desk at the entrance
Your costume must be a character that has appeared in a fighting game.
Handmade and bought costumes are both acceptable, however handmade costumes will be rated higher in judging.
Any costumes you have worn that have won awards at any prior competitions will not be eligible for prizes.
Appropriate footwear must be worn at all times.
Cosplayers with large costume pieces such as props, wings or utilising stilts may be asked to move away from crowded areas or restricted from certain areas.
Effects such as Smoke, Bubbles, etc, are not to be used inside the venue.
Do not use flashing lights, etc, around other attendees.
When you’re on stage – embody the character! Memorise some of your favourite poses of your character and get ready for a small chat on stage.
We will award based on craftsmanship, overall looks and attitude on stage! We can’t wait to see you share your life of Fighting Game characters on the stage with us, so have fun!!
The following items are not allowed to be brought to BAM:
Any prop that can fire any type of projectile. If the prop is a bow, it must be unstrung or string with low-tensile thread.
Any kind of replica firearm or airsoft weapon (including any that have been decommissioned)
Any prop constructed out of metal such as swords, knives & spears. Any prop that is sharp or pointy enough to cut or pierce with moderate pressure is not allowed. This includes, but is not limited to, real swords, daggers, knives, ceramic blades, needles, syringes.
